FUHSO Receives NUC Approval for Four New Health Sciences Programmes
The Federal University of Health Sciences, Otukpo (FUHSO) has secured approval from the National Universities Commission (NUC) to run four new academic programmes, effective from the 2024/2025 academic session.
Newly Approved Programmes
The NUC has approved the following programmes:
- Doctor of Pharmacy (Pharm. D)
- Bachelor of Medical Laboratory Science (BMLS)
- Bachelor of Nursing Science (BNSc)
- Bachelor of Science in Public Health and Epidemiology (B.Sc.)
Background
The approval came after a successful resource verification visit by an NUC panel on August 30, 2025. According to reports, the panel commended the university for its state-of-the-art infrastructure, modern facilities, and high-quality teaching resources that met and exceeded the Commission's standards.
